Northweald is a wilderness area in Pillars of Eternity.

Background

A large stretch of the wilderness north of Twin Elms, Northweald lies on the edge of the area affected by the War of Black Trees, with half of it still bearing the scars of the war, and the other pristine, kept safe by the river and the Sentinel's Waterfall.

Points of interest

  • You enter the area from the southwest. Just a short distance to the north is the Pilgrims' Camp, tied to At the Mercy of the Tribes. The hidden container in the pillar has a potion.
  • Head east over the river to run into Cwineth if you agreed to help her. Farther to the southeast lies a trail leading to an isolated mesa, where the Fangs have cornered the Dyrwoodan expedition. It's a little deeper in the mesa, hiding among the ruins, with Esmar, their captain, standing in the center.
  • In the center, along the northern edge, is a large spotted stelgaer laying dead on its side, tied to Hunter, Brother. You can interact with its soul to learn what happened to it - and that Arthwn definitely did not kill it. At the bottom, near the waterfall, lies the body of Fîorm.
  • The way to the Temple of Hylea lies in the upper left corner, among the ruins of an Engwithan temple. A Torc of the Falcon's Eyes is hidden nearby.
  • Finally, towards the end of The Long Hunt, Persoq is found on the ledge, surrounded by Glanfathan hunters. The entrance to the cave is nearby. It contains a group of Pŵgras and Lurkers, as well as the Mênpŵgra Devŵen, if her bounty is active. A pair of Glanfathan Stalking Boots can be found on a skeleton near the back of the cave.
